SSP Platforms: A Comparative Overview for Publishers

In the dynamic world of online advertising, Demand-based SSP platforms have emerged as vital tools for publishers to maximize their ad revenue. An SSP acts as a primary platform that connects publishers with advertisers, facilitating the buying and selling of ad space. Selecting the right SSP is crucial for publishers to ensure profitability and success in a competitive market landscape.

  • Several factors should be analyzed when comparing SSP platforms, including capabilities, cost-per-click schemes, and the range of demand partners connected.
  • Moreover, publishers should prioritize platforms that deliver robust data insights to measure effectiveness and adjust campaigns.

Finally, a comprehensive knowledge of the available SSP platforms and their respective benefits is essential for publishers to make strategic choices.

Optimizing Your Performance: Mastering CPM, CPC, and CPA Models

Navigating the complex world of online advertising can seem overwhelming. With countless metrics and models vying for your attention, it's easy to become lost in a sea of jargon. However, understanding the fundamentals of key performance indicators like CPM, CPC, and CPA can equip you to make strategic decisions that maximize your advertising ROI. Let's delve into these models and uncover how they can help you attain your campaign goals.

  • First, let's define CPM, which stands for "Cost Per Mille." This metric indicates the cost of displaying your ad one thousand times.
  • Next, we have CPC, or "Cost Per Click." This model costs you every time a user clicks with your advertisement.
  • Finally, there's CPA, or "Cost Per Action." CPA focuses on the price associated with each desired action taken by a user, such as making a purchase, filling out a form, or subscribing to a newsletter.

Choosing the right model depends on your specific advertising objectives and target audience.
